Crypto stocks sink after Senate rejects Clarity Act, Coinbase slides nearly 9%

Crypto stocks were a sea of red Tuesday afternoon after the Senate failed to advance the Clarity Act, dealing a major blow to an industry that has spent years — and hundreds of millions of dollars in campaign contributions — gunning for a comprehensive U.S. regulatory framework.

Coinbase · was down nearly 9% at $174.42, while stablecoin issuer Circle · dropped 9.4% to $88.26. Galaxy Digital · lost 8% and Gemini (GEMI) fell 7%.

The pain spread across the sector. Robinhood · was down 3%, Bullish · lost 5% and eToro (ETOR) fell 4%.

Among crypto miners, Riot Platforms · dropped 5%, while MARA Holdings ·, CleanSpark ·, IREN and Core Scientific · were all down between roughly 3% and 4%.

The declines came after the Senate voted 49-50 on a procedural motion to advance the Digital Asset Market Clarity Act, well short of the 60 votes required.

The bill would have set rules for how different cryptocurrencies and blockchain projects are treated in the U.S., while giving the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) greater authority over crypto spot markets.
